The document outlines the Treasury's framework for regulatory reform, focusing first on containing systemic risk. It discusses establishing a single regulator for systemically important firms, higher capital and risk management standards for such firms, requiring registration of large hedge funds, regulating over-the-counter derivatives markets, strengthening money market fund regulation, and creating stronger resolution authority for failing complex institutions. The framework aims to modernize financial oversight and prevent future crises.
